What is Ebola?

Ebola, also known as Ebola virus disease (EVD), is a severe and often fatal illness caused by the Ebola virus. The virus is part of the Filoviridae family and is primarily found in Africa. According to Johns Hopkins Medicine, Ebola is characterized by its high mortality rate, with case fatality rates ranging from 25% to 90% in different outbreaks.

Symptoms of Ebola

The symptoms of Ebola can vary, but they often begin with sudden onset of fever, fatigue, muscle pain, and headache. As the disease progresses, patients may experience vomiting, diarrhea, abdominal pain, and bleeding or bruising. Johns Hopkins Medicine emphasizes that early recognition of these symptoms is crucial for prompt medical attention and treatment.

Transmission of Ebola

Ebola is primarily spread through direct contact with infected bodily fluids, such as blood, sweat, and saliva. This can occur through: Touching infected patients or their bodily fluids Contact with contaminated medical equipment or surfaces Handling or preparing infected animals for consumption Johns Hopkins Medicine stresses the importance of proper infection control measures, including wearing personal protective equipment (PPE) and following strict hygiene protocols, to prevent the spread of Ebola.

Treatment and Prevention

While there is no specific cure for Ebola, treatment focuses on supportive care, such as: Fluid replacement Oxygen therapy Management of symptoms Prevention of complications Johns Hopkins Medicine has been involved in the development and testing of experimental treatments, including ZMapp and brincidofovir. These treatments have shown promising results in reducing mortality rates and improving patient outcomes.

Prevention Measures

Prevention is key to controlling the spread of Ebola. Johns Hopkins Medicine recommends: Practicing good hygiene, including frequent handwashing Avoiding close contact with infected individuals Wearing PPE when interacting with patients or handling contaminated materials Following safe burial practices for deceased patients
